  • A couple is hailing a pair of middle schoolers as heroes after the 12- and 13-year-olds saved their three dogs from a house fire. Mario Comella and Anthony Lombardi were passing a neighbor’s house when they heard a fire alarm going off inside. They called the homeowners, and were able to get the code to open the front door. When they opened it, they were met with smoke - but braved the danger to ensure the three dogs inside got out to safety.
